About
A palmitic-acid-modified version of the amino acid proline — works as a skin-conditioning lipid that mimics the skin's own barrier chemistry. Gentle and well tolerated; often paired with magnesium palmitoyl glutamate.
Skin benefits
- Amino-acid-based skin conditioner
- Mild emulsion stabiliser
- Boosts barrier feel
- Bioidentical to skin chemistry
Known concerns
- No significant concerns at cosmetic concentrations
